“First Album for American Organ and Harmonium” is a selection of organ music designed for new and novice players of the organ, selected and arranged by Purcell J. Mansfield. Chosen for their relative simplicity to learn and perform, these pieces are ideal for modern readers who are only just beginning their exiting musical journey with the church organ or harmonium. Contents include: “Easter Hymn from ‘Cavalleria Rusticana'”, “Afton Water”, “Allegretto Pensoso”, “Andante Cantabile”, “Andantino in F”, “Bonnie Wee Thing”, “Shannon River”, “Down the Mall”, “Forget-Me-Not”, “Interlude”, “Intermezzo from ‘Cavalleria Rusticanna'”, “A Prayer at Eventide”, “The Broken Melody”, “Introduction and Andante”, etc. Many vintage books such as this are increasingly scarce and expensive. It is with this in mind that we are republishing this volume now in an affordable, modern, high-quality edition complete with a specially-commissioned new introduction on the history of the organ.
